[0001] This utility model belongs to the field of packaging box forming and processing technology, specifically, it relates to a foam plastic packaging box forming and processing device. Background Technology
[0002] The foam plastic packaging box molding and processing equipment is a professional equipment system used to produce foam plastic packaging boxes. Its core function is to make packaging products with cushioning and heat insulation properties by foaming thermoplastic resins such as polystyrene and polypropylene.
[0003] The prior art discloses a foam box production device with a compaction component (CN218139419U), including a support base. The support base consists of a base plate with support plates symmetrically welded to its upper end. A through groove is formed on the side of the support plate, and grooves are symmetrically formed on both sides of the through groove. A movable groove is symmetrically formed at the lower end of the through groove. A fixed arm is provided between the two support plates. The beneficial effects of this invention are: after the foam box is compacted, the motor shaft drives the main gear to rotate, which in turn drives the transmission gear ring to rotate 180 degrees. The transmission gear ring then drives the lower mold base to rotate 180 degrees via a rotating shaft. Through the cooperation of a shaking mechanism and a reset mechanism, the movable plate shakes up and down. The movable plate, via the rotating shaft, drives the lower mold base to shake up and down, allowing the foam box inside the lower mold base to fall down quickly, thus unloading the formed foam box. The operation is simple and convenient, greatly improving work efficiency.
[0004] Research revealed that existing technologies use a rotating and flipping method to remove foam boxes from the mold base. However, this method ignores the adhesiveness of foam boxes during the thermoplastic molding process, causing the foam to soften and stick to the mold during demolding, resulting in defects in the foam box and affecting its appearance. Furthermore, existing technologies use a single workstation to process and mold foam boxes, which results in relatively low work efficiency and cannot meet the needs of mass production of foam boxes.

[0016] Compared with the prior art, the present invention has the following advantages:
[0017] 1. The air-cooling and water-cooling components work together. The air-cooling component can quickly remove heat from the surface of the foam plastic packaging box, initially reducing its temperature. The water-cooling component penetrates deep into the outer layer of the mold to further cool the foam plastic packaging box, ensuring that its internal structure is completely solidified and reducing quality problems such as product deformation caused by insufficient or uneven cooling. With the help of the electric push rod pushing the ejector plate, the foam plastic packaging box can be smoothly ejected from the water-cooled mold base, effectively preventing the foam from softening and sticking to the mold, thereby avoiding defects in the foam box body and ensuring the appearance quality and performance of the product.
[0018] 2. This device is equipped with a workstation switching component, which can quickly switch workstations by turning the handle. There is no need for tedious operations such as manually changing molds or waiting for molds to reset. The four receiving seats correspond to four different workstations, and raw materials can be placed at the same time. Then, the molding and cooling demolding are carried out in an orderly manner, which greatly improves production efficiency and can meet the needs of mass production of foam boxes.

[0033] like Figure 1 and Figure 3 As shown, the air-cooled assembly includes an air supply pipe 14, a jet ring pipe 25, and a telescopic pipe 26. An air pump 24 is fixedly installed on the top of one side of the base 10. The air pump 24 is located on one side of the hydraulic cylinder 15. The air supply pipe 14 is connected to the top of the telescopic pipe 26 through the air pump 24. The bottom of the telescopic pipe 26 is connected to the jet ring pipe 25. The outlet end of the jet ring pipe 25 is fixed through the top of the upper mold base 16. The jet ring pipe 25 consists of a square ring pipe and multiple jet pipes arranged in an array. Multiple through holes are arranged in an array on the upper mold base 16. The square ring pipe is fixed to the top surface of the upper mold base 16 by clamps and bolts. The jet pipes pass through the corresponding through holes. The air supply pipe 14 is connected to an external compressed air machine for supplying compressed air.
[0034] The working principle is as follows: When the equipment is working, the air pump 24 starts, and the external compressed air compressor delivers compressed air to the air pump 24 through the air delivery pipe 14. The air pump 24 further delivers the compressed air to the jet ring pipe 25 through the telescopic pipe 26. Due to the special structure of the jet ring pipe 25, the compressed air can be evenly sprayed from multiple jet pipes and evenly sprayed around the foam plastic packaging box, which cools the foam plastic packaging box formed in the upper mold base 16. The telescopic pipe 26 ensures that even if the upper mold base 16 moves up and down under the drive of the hydraulic cylinder 15 during the operation of the equipment, it will not affect the normal operation of the air cooling components, thus ensuring the continuity and stability of the air cooling.
[0035] like Figure 2 , Figure 4 and Figure 5 As shown, the water cooling assembly includes a water supply pipe 13 and a circulating water pipe 21. A circulating water pump 20 is fixedly installed on one outer wall of the base 10. The water supply pipe 13 is connected to the circulating water pipe 21 through the circulating water pump 20. Both ends of the circulating water pipe 21 are connected to the circulating water pump 20. The circulating water pipe 21 is installed inside the water cooling mold base 17.
[0036] like Figure 2 and Figure 4 As shown, the receiving seat 18 is correspondingly set at the bottom of the water-cooled mold base 17. The ejector plate 22 is snapped into the receiving seat 18. An electric push rod 23 is fixedly provided on the bottom surface of the receiving seat 18. The output end of the electric push rod 23 passes through the receiving seat 18 and connects to the bottom surface of the ejector plate 22. The ejector plate 22 slides through the inside of the water-cooled mold base 17.
[0037] The working principle is as follows: the water supply pipe 13 is connected to a cooling water tank. When the circulating water pump 20 is working, it draws the cooling water in the cooling water tank through the water supply pipe 13 and sends it into the circulating water pipe 21. The cooling water circulates in the circulating water pipe 21, carrying away the heat inside the water-cooled mold base 17, thereby cooling the foam plastic packaging box formed inside the water-cooled mold base 17. The circulating water pipe 21 ensures uniform contact and cooling with the mold base inside the water-cooled mold base 17, so that all parts of the foam plastic packaging box are cooled evenly, effectively avoiding product deformation or quality problems caused by uneven cooling.

[0040] The working principle and specific implementation method are as follows: During use, according to production needs, set parameters such as the stroke and speed of the hydraulic cylinder 15, the air output of the air pump 24, and the water flow rate of the circulating water pump 20 on the control panel 11. Rotate the handle 12 to change the workstation to a suitable position, so that the receiving seat 18 is located below the water-cooled mold base 17. Place the foam plastic raw material into the water-cooled mold base 17 and the receiving seat 18. Start the hydraulic cylinder 15; the upper mold base 16 moves downward under the drive of the hydraulic cylinder 15, extruding and molding the foam plastic raw material between the upper mold base 16 and the water-cooled mold base 17. During the molding process, the air pump 24 can be started as needed to assist in cooling the raw material in the upper mold base 16 through the air-cooling component. To ensure molding quality, after molding is completed, the upper mold base 16 moves upward and resets under the drive of the hydraulic cylinder 15. At this time, the circulating water pump 20 is started, and the foam plastic packaging box in the water-cooled mold base 17 is cooled by water cooling components. At the same time, the air cooling components can continue to work to accelerate the cooling speed. After cooling is completed, the electric push rod 23 is started. The electric push rod 23 pushes the ejector plate 22 to eject the foam plastic packaging box from the water-cooled mold base 17. The operator takes out the product and selects to turn the handle 12. The handle 12 drives the shift rod 28 to rotate. Since the shift rod 28 is off the center of the conversion plate 19 and is in the cross groove 29, the rotation of the shift rod 28 will push the conversion plate 19 to rotate a certain angle, thereby realizing the conversion of the work position.
